Structured vs Unstructured Time
Structured activities are not bad. Piano lessons, soccer practice, and homework all matter. The problem is the ratio — when scheduled time crowds out free time entirely.
Aim for at least one hour daily where your child has:
- No screens
- No instructions
- No agenda
This is not neglect. It is one of the most developmentally powerful things you can offer — so watch what happens when you don't step in.
